Mike Dow, incoming Club President, presented his plans for the year 2021-22 at the club’s assembly.

Mike said there would be renewed focus on environmental and community projects which, with members being seen working in the community, would in turn increase the club’s public profile.

Learning from lockdown, the club aimed to offer practical community support, reinforce fellowship and continue to embrace online meetings.

Mike presented his charity budget proposals and how Kilrymont would continue to support local groups.

He said he would like to see expansion in all areas of the club’s work including youth and community service projects. Mike added that he would also like to see an increase in membership.

District Governor Nominee for 2021-22, Jim Hatter, from Inverurie, acted as external AG assessor and praised Kilrymont for its ambitious plans and wished the club well in achieving its aims.
